Area Overview for IG8 9DH

Area Information

Living in IG8 9DH means settling in a small, tightly knit residential cluster in England, home to 1,549 people. This area is defined by its compact size and proximity to key transport links, making it a practical choice for those seeking a balance between urban convenience and quieter living. The community here is predominantly composed of adults aged 30–64, with a median age of 47, suggesting a stable, mature population. Daily life is shaped by the local infrastructure: nearby retail hubs like Tesco Woodford and Waitrose South offer everyday essentials, while rail and metro stations provide easy access to London’s broader network. The area’s low flood risk and below-average crime rates add to its appeal, though its small size means amenities are limited to immediate surroundings. For those prioritising safety, connectivity, and a sense of community, IG8 9DH offers a straightforward, no-frills lifestyle with minimal environmental or planning constraints.

The lifestyle in IG8 9DH is shaped by its proximity to retail, transport, and local services. Within practical reach are major retailers like Tesco Woodford and Waitrose South, alongside M&S South Woodford, offering a range of shopping options. The area’s transport links—Highams Park Station, Wood Street Station, and Walthamstow Central—provide direct access to London’s rail network, while metro stations at South Woodford and Snaresbrook connect to broader regional routes. The presence of Whipps Cross Bus Interchange adds to the area’s accessibility, though the single bus route may not match the density of rail services.
